  12. [SPEAKER_00]: throw my hat in the ring, throw my hat in the ring.

  13. [SPEAKER_00]: This is no statement and old saying that had been said many, many years ago in 1805 there was an issue of a sporting magazine where a boxer had said out loud he was going to throw and even did.

  14. [SPEAKER_00]: He threw his hat in the ring.

  15. [SPEAKER_00]: If throwing his hat into the ring to defy his opponents and show his confidence

  16. [SPEAKER_00]: and see if he wanted to accept his challenge.

  17. [SPEAKER_00]: And so that was an 1805.

  18. [SPEAKER_00]: Well, what until 1810, 1810, a challenge presented was presented by an empire, by an empire, where different opponents had answered the call to the fight, finally.

  19. [SPEAKER_00]: They had thrown their hats back into the ring of took five years.

  20. [SPEAKER_00]: I don't know if it was just for a timidation that a man decided to throw his hat in the ring.

  21. [SPEAKER_00]: And finally, five years later, people started answering back a fact.

  22. [SPEAKER_00]: You're a few who had thrown their hats back in.

  23. [SPEAKER_00]: And they didn't ever say if the guy was beaten or not, my assumption is he was, but I have no idea.

  24. [SPEAKER_00]: But we do know that it became a very well-known statement of well-known saying throwing your hat to the ring of fact.

  25. [SPEAKER_00]: In 1865, this is where it really got extremely well-known.

  26. [SPEAKER_00]: It was 1865 PT Barnum.

  27. [SPEAKER_00]: used the idiom as to saying the idiom while literally throwing his top hat into the circus ring that he of course owned to represent his candidacy to become the Connecticut house of representatives then later on became a mayor in Bridgeport, Connecticut and others began to use this phrase and now is a common statement especially when it comes to political things and others are going to throw their hat into the ring and the title today's sermons hat in the ring, hat in the ring.
